使用get請求傳參json串是一種常見的Web開發方式。在實際的開發過程中,我們通常會將相關的參數封裝成一個json串,并通過get請求將該json串提交到服務端。
$.ajax({ type: "GET", url: "/api/user", data: { user: JSON.stringify({ name: "張三", age: 18 }) }, dataType: "json", success: function(data){ }, error: function(error){ } });
在上述代碼中,我們使用了jQuery的ajax方法,通過type參數指定了請求方式為get。在data參數中,我們將參數封裝成了一個json對象,并通過JSON.stringify方法將其轉換為json串。在服務端,可以通過request對象獲取該json串,并進行相關的處理。
使用get請求傳參json串的優點是簡單、快速,適用于一些簡單的場景。但是該方式也存在一些缺點,比如無法傳遞較大的數據,容易被惡意攻擊者截獲請求,數據傳輸不安全等問題。在實際開發中,應該根據具體情況選擇合適的請求方式來傳遞參數。
上一篇get請求參數 json
下一篇vue如何獲取class